Onion links signify a unique method of accessing information on the dark web. These layered links are designed to conceal the true destination, making them difficult to track. Navigating onion links requires specific software like Tor, which secures your connection and disguises your location. The nature of these links often makes them associated with underground activities, but they also offer a platform for confidential communication and access to restricted information.

Delving into the Secrets of Tor's Hidden Web
Tor's hidden web, often referred to as the Onion Network, is a realm shrouded in mystery and intrigue. This cyber underworld operates on a anonymous network, providing users with a shield of privacy and security. Tucked away this labyrinthine network lie hidden services, offering an eclectic mix of illicit goods and services to safe spaces.
Accessing the hidden web requires specialized software like the Tor browser, which encrypts your traffic, making it highly challenging to trace. Due to this heightened level of anonymity, the hidden web has become a haven for criminal activity.
However, it's important to note that not every on the hidden web is nefarious. There are also legitimate uses for Tor, such as preserving onionlinks freedom of speech in countries with oppressive regimes.
